Seretide 250 Evohaler is a trusted combination inhaler used for the maintenance treatment of asthma and ch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D). It contains two active components: Salmeterol, a long-acting bronchodilator that relaxes airway muscles, and Fluticasone Propionate, a corticosteroid that reduces inflammation in the lungs. Designed for daily use, Seretide 250 Evohaler helps prevent breathing difficulties such as wheezing, coughing, and shortness of breath. It is not suitable for treating sudden asthma attacks but plays a critical role in long-term respiratory management. Proper inhalation technique and consistency are essential for optimal results. Mild side effects such as throat irritation, oral thrush, or headaches may occur. Rinsing the mouth after use reduces the risk of fungal infections. Use only as prescribed by a healthcare professional.

Seretide 250 Evohaler – Asthma and COPD Management

Seretide 250 Evohaler is a prescription inhalation medicine used in the management of asthma and ch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D). It contains two active components: Salmeterol, a bronchodilator, and Fluticasone Propionate, a corticosteroid. Together, they improve airflow, reduce inflammation, and help prevent the recurrence of breathing difficulties.

How Seretide Evohaler Works?

  • Salmeterol: A long-acting beta-2 adrenergic agonist that dilates the airways by relaxing the airway muscles, making breathing easier.
  • Fluticasone Propionate: An inhaled corticosteroid that reduces airway inflammation by blocking inflammatory mediators.

Dosage and Administration:

Use as directed by your physician. Shake the inhaler well. Inhale the medication while pressing down the inhaler, and hold your breath for 10 seconds. Rinse your mouth thoroughly after each use.

Side Effects:

Most side effects are temporary and do not require medical attention. Contact your doctor if they persist.

  • Cough
  • Upper respiratory tract infection
  • Nasopharyngitis (throat and nasal inflammation)
  • Sinusitis
  • Fungal infection in the mouth (oropharynx)
  • Voice change
  • Headache
  • Dry mouth
  • Nausea or vomiting
  • Aggressive behavior

Safety and Precautions:

  • Alcohol: Not enough data; consult your doctor before consuming alcohol.
  • Pregnancy: May be unsafe during pregnancy. Use only if clearly needed and prescribed.
  • Breastfeeding: Safety not established. Use only after consulting with a healthcare provider.
  • Driving: No specific precautions required.
  • Kidney/Liver: No known significant interaction; inform your doctor if you have any liver or kidney condition.

Missed Dose?

If you miss a dose, take it as soon as you remember. If it’s almost time for the next dose, skip the missed one. Do not double up doses.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s):

What is Seretide 250 Evohaler?

It is an inhaler medication combining salmeterol (bronchodilator) and fluticasone (corticosteroid) used for treating asthma and COPD.

How does it work?

Salmeterol helps in keeping airways open, while fluticasone reduces inflammation inside the lungs.

Is it a controller or reliever inhaler?

It is a controller inhaler. It should be used daily for long-term control, not for sudden asthma attacks.

Does it contain steroids?

Yes. Fluticasone is a corticosteroid which controls inflammation. It is safer when inhaled compared to oral steroids.

Can Seretide Evohaler increase heart rate?

In some cases, yes. If you notice rapid heartbeat or palpitations, consult your doctor.

Is Seretide 250 Evohaler addictive?

No. It is not addictive and is safe for long-term use under medical supervision.

Will taking more puffs improve its effect?

No. Exceeding the prescribed dose increases side effects and does not provide additional benefit.

Can diabetic patients use it?

It may raise blood sugar levels. Diabetics should monitor glucose levels and inform the doctor.

Is any special inhalation technique needed?

Yes. It is a metered-dose inhaler (MDI). Proper coordination of breathing and actuation is needed. Refer to the leaflet or consult your doctor for technique training.

What precautions are necessary?

  • Rinse mouth after use to prevent fungal infections.
  • Use it regularly even if you feel well.
  • Do not stop without doctor’s advice.
  • Report side effects promptly.
